The role of moxibustion and cupping

Moxibustion and cupping, moxibustion has the effect of stretching the tendons (stretching the tendons, dredging the meridians), warming the meridians and dispersing cold (warming the meridians of the human body, dispelling the cold in the body), and cupping has the effect of opening up the meridians and promoting circulation and eliminating the swelling and dispersing the cold. 1. Moxibustion is the use of moxa burning heat, the role of the relevant lesions in the skin and acupuncture points, the burning of moxa medicinal properties and heat into the lesions of a treatment method, with the tendons and muscles (stretching the tendons and bones, dredge the meridians), support the Yang fixed off (by the way of the Yang to treat prolapse type of disease), warming the meridians and dispersal of cold (warming the meridians of the human body to get rid of the body’s cold), and lead to the heat of the outward movement of the role of the. It is often used in the treatment of arthritis, disintegration (excessive menstrual flow or dribbling) and other diseases. 2. Cupping is to produce negative pressure through various methods, adsorbed in the relevant points and meridians of the human body to achieve the effect of activating the meridians, eliminating swelling and dispersing cold, benefiting qi and activating blood (replenishing qi and blood to make the body full of qi and blood and blood), etc., and is commonly used in the treatment of rheumatism and paralysis, arthralgia, menstrual cramps, and other diseases. Moxibustion and cupping are both external treatments of traditional Chinese medicine, and need to be carried out by a professional physician after clear identification of the disease, so as to avoid blind treatment, leading to adverse consequences.
